A. nodosum, commonly know as egg-wrack, is a brown seaweed with large swollen egg shaped air bladders at intervals along the middle of the frond. Ascophyllum nodosum is naturally rich in vitamins, minerals and amino acids including: Alginic acid, Ascorbic acid, Mannitol, Laminaran, vitamins E, C, B1, B2, B3, B6, B12, K3, Calcium, Copper, Phosphorous, Potassium, Manganese, Magnesium and Zinc. The central stalk of seaweed is flexible to prevent any breakage that might otherwise result from strong wave action.Noteworthy too is that ascophyllum nodosum produces a noxious secondary chemical which is effective at repelling herbivores, or at least discouraging the would-be consumers from over-eating.
